Painel de dispositivos de áudio

Muitos testes de áudio do CTS Verifier validam recursos em vários dispositivos de hardware de áudio. O painel Audio Devices indica quais dispositivos de áudio são compatíveis com o DUT e quais estão disponíveis para uso.

A lista de dispositivos compatíveis mostra os dispositivos de áudio que o DUT pode usar, mas não estão necessariamente conectados e, portanto, não estão disponíveis no momento do teste. AudioManager.getSupportedDeviceTypes(), adicionado no SDK 35, retorna os tipos de dispositivo com suporte.

A figura a seguir mostra que o DUT oferece suporte aos dispositivos integrados (como microfone, alto-falante e fone de ouvido), periféricos de áudio analógico, periféricos de áudio Bluetooth e periféricos de áudio USB:

Suporte ao painel de dispositivos de áudio

Figura 1. Painel "Audio Devices" mostrando os dispositivos compatíveis.

A lista Available Devices mostra os dispositivos de áudio que podem ser usados no momento do teste, seja porque estão integrados ao DUT (como o alto-falante interno e o microfone) ou conectados (como um fone de ouvido analógico ou um periférico de áudio USB).

A figura a seguir mostra que apenas os dispositivos integrados estão disponíveis para uso, ou seja, não há periféricos de áudio externos conectados ao DUT:

Painel de dispositivos de áudio disponível

Figura 2. Painel "Audio Devices" mostrando os dispositivos disponíveis.

Se a lista de dispositivos com suporte não corresponder ao hardware que está no dispositivo (Inputs), pode haver um problema na configuração da política de áudio fornecida pelo HAL. Se os dispositivos disponíveis não corresponderem ao que está conectado ao dispositivo (Saídas), talvez haja um problema com a camada do software de áudio.

Quando os periféricos de áudio são conectados ao DUT, a lista de dispositivos disponíveis é atualizada para refletir a configuração.